Title | Deed of exchange made between 1. Mary Shuttleworth of Aston widow of James Shuttleworth esquire deceased and James Holden of Derby esquire. 2. Joseph Greaves of Aston esquire |
Date | 5 Apr 1776 |
Description | By which 1. granted to 2. Robert Gaskins House and Homestead, John Gees House and Homestead, Abraham Burtons House and Homestead and Jacob Bothams Barn and Yard with outbuildings in town of Aston, all in occupation of persons named, and containing 5 acres 18p and 2. granted to 1. his farm house and homestead with outbuildings in Aston in his tenure and containing 2 acres 26p and piece of land lying in the Breach Meadow (boundaries given in detail) containing 6 acres 2r 5p |
